It was with sad news that we are to announce the sudden passing of Neil L Russo Jr. Affectionally. Known as "Junior". Neil was born on November 8,1929 in White Plains NY and was the son of Neil Sr and Stepmother Elinor Russo (Predeceased). He married his wife Maria on April 30, 1961, in Italy and celebrated 63 years of marriage. Besides his wife Maria, he is survived by his son Alfred and Marianne (Daughter in law) of New Port Richey, Florida, daughter Antoinette and Daniel Dapice (Son in law) of White Plains, NY and grandsons Anthony and Joseph Dapice of White Plains New York.
Neil served in the U.S Army and was stationed in Berlin, Germany from 1952-1954 and was honorable discharged.
He was employed for 35 years by the Archdiocese of New York, Gate of Heaven Cemetery in Valhalla, New York where he assisted funeral staff and priests. He was very thoughtful to all during their time in need.
He was a longtime parishioner of St John's and Our Lady of Mt Carmel in White Plains, New York where in his younger days volunteered. Neil was a devout Catholic and attended Mass daily.
Neil enjoyed yearly family vacations, walking, beach, gardening and going to Yankee Stadium. He also enjoyed watching western movies and was a big music fan, especially attending the Rolling Stones concert at the Meadowlands. He loved playing checkers and cards with his grandsons.
Neil was a quiet man with a big heart, His faith in God and love for his family spoke volumes. Always doing for others before himself. He had the most beautiful dark blue eyes, which always shined. Our loss here is Heaven's gain. Rest in peace "Junior" beloved husband, father and grandfather until we meet you again.
